Commit Graph

75 Commits (5cd1880daa048a685da689c7f41a2e50486494de)

Author SHA1 Message Date
dependabot-preview[bot] eb502c02ff
Bump nextcloud/coding-standard from 0.3.0 to 0.5.0 5 years ago
Christoph Wurst 8b64e92b92
Bump doctrine/dbal from 2.12.0 to 3.0.0 5 years ago
Morris Jobke dc479aae2d
Improve CertificateManager to not be user context dependent 5 years ago
lynn-stephenson a3bdb0c4cb
Implement unit tests for versions 1 and 2. 5 years ago
Christoph Wurst d9015a8c94
Format code to a single space around binary operators 5 years ago
Joas Schilling c25063dc07
Don't break when the IP is empty 5 years ago
Morris Jobke 234b510652
Change PHPDoc type hint from PHPUnit_Framework_MockObject_MockObject to \PHPUnit\Framework\MockObject\MockObject 5 years ago
Roeland Jago Douma 35ff4aa1c6
Use random_bytes 6 years ago
MichaIng ad60619655
Fix Argon2 options checks 6 years ago
Arthur Schiwon 5437844b7e
fix credentialsManager documentation and ensure userId to be used as string 6 years ago
Arthur Schiwon f6cb452037
add DB tests for credentials manager 6 years ago
Christoph Wurst 1584c9ae9c
Add visibility to all methods and position of static keyword 6 years ago
Christoph Wurst caff1023ea
Format control structures, classes, methods and function 6 years ago
Christoph Wurst afbd9c4e6e
Unify function spacing to PSR2 recommendation 6 years ago
Christoph Wurst 2a529e453a
Use a blank line after the opening tag 6 years ago
Christoph Wurst 41b5e5923a
Use exactly one empty line after the namespace declaration 6 years ago
Christoph Wurst b80ebc9674
Use the short array syntax, everywhere 6 years ago
Christoph Wurst 2ee65f177e
Use the shorter phpunit syntax for mocked return values 6 years ago
Christoph Wurst 74936c49ea
Remove unused imports 6 years ago
Roeland Jago Douma 12e1c469cf
Add Argon2id support 6 years ago
Roeland Jago Douma 0d651f106c
Allow selecting the hashing algorithm 6 years ago
Julius Härtl d05f131929
Move overwritehost check to isTrustedDomain 6 years ago
Roeland Jago Douma 3a7cf40aaa
Mode to modern phpunit 6 years ago
Roeland Jago Douma c007ca624f
Make phpunit8 compatible 6 years ago
Roeland Jago Douma 68748d4f85
Some php-cs fixes 6 years ago
Johannes Koenig 2df8d646c1 make TrustedDomainHelper case insensitive 6 years ago
Roeland Jago Douma 2b98eea129
Harden identifyproof openssl code 6 years ago
Roeland Jago Douma 7927aebdeb
Fix report of phpstan in Limiter 6 years ago
Roeland Jago Douma f81817b47d
Add tests 6 years ago
Roeland Jago Douma cf647451e5
Update CSP test cases to handle the new form-action 7 years ago
Sam Bull ea935f65fd
Add support for CSP_NONCE server variable 7 years ago
Roeland Jago Douma 5ac857bcdc
Add an event to edit the CSP 7 years ago
Roeland Jago Douma f1ea56b502
Fix the thorrtler whitelist bitmask 7 years ago
Roeland Jago Douma ad676c0102
Set default frame-ancestors to 'self' 7 years ago
Roeland Jago Douma 64244e1a4f
CSP: Allow fonts to be provided in data 7 years ago
Thomas Citharel c9b588774b
Allow bracket IPv6 address format inside IPAdress Normalizer 7 years ago
Roeland Jago Douma 5b61ef9213
Disallow unsafe-eval by default 7 years ago
Roeland Jago Douma 362e6b2903
Fix tests 8 years ago
Roeland Jago Douma 84316aec66
Add ARGON2I support to the hasher 8 years ago
Joas Schilling bf2be08c9f
Fix risky tests without assertions 8 years ago
Roeland Jago Douma 0e0db37658
Make OCP\Security stricter 8 years ago
Roeland Jago Douma cf0a339997
Make OC\Security\RateLimiting strict 8 years ago
Roeland Jago Douma 094d41937a
Fix tests 8 years ago
Morris Jobke c733cdaa65
Use ::class in test mocks of encryption app 8 years ago
Morris Jobke 43e498844e
Use ::class in test mocks 8 years ago
Bjoern Schiessle bae5be3dc1
add prefix to user and system keys to avoid name collisions 9 years ago
Bjoern Schiessle 9524badccc
extend the identity proof manager to allow system wide key pairs 9 years ago
Roeland Jago Douma 6a1f2ac076
Add bruteforce capabilities 9 years ago
Roeland Jago Douma 04f2090698
Write cert bundle to tmp file first 9 years ago
Joas Schilling ca39940614
Automatic creation of Identity manager 9 years ago